All of you might all ready know this but just for the few young drivers who dont, there is a way to get 'reasonable' insurance for your first few years of driving while earning your own NCB. and it does not involve the thing which direct line does.
on your policy add your parents as named drivers instead of you been name drivers. im 18 now got 1 years named driving experience and i want my own policy. so i have gone with admiral and added both my parents on my 1.4 16v sri corsa as named drivers. i have said that there is no years no claims but that my parents have held there licences for how many years they have and its come back for 3rd party fire and theft with 750 pound worth of sterio damage and no years no claims
my final price is.......... £841 which i think is quite good what do you think? let me no
